About This Opportunity
The Swedish Society for Medical Research (SSMF) offers travel grants for doctoral students active in preclinical and clinical medical research in Sweden. The grant supports up to 50,000 SEK and can be awarded a maximum of three times to the same individual. The grants are intended to cover personal costs for travel and accommodation in connection with visits to other research institutions or clinics for studies of significance to the doctoral student's own research project. Examples include travel to learn new methodologies, collect research data, or other similar purposes. The grant is tax-free and paid directly to the recipient. Doctoral students registered at a Swedish university with at least one peer-reviewed original publication are eligible to apply. The research article must have been published after registration as a doctoral student or in connection with doctoral studies, and in such cases at most one year before registration as a doctoral student. The grants are not awarded for courses, conference or congress travel, materials, printing or other operational costs, nor for per diem or compensation for food costs during the period.
